FAQ (Buying & Transaction Focused)
1. How does Oopbuy handle international purchases?
Orders are processed through a centralized agent system before global shipping.
2. What happens after I place an order?
The item is purchased, checked, and prepared for shipping consolidation.
3. Can I combine multiple purchases?
Yes, consolidation is commonly used to reduce shipping costs.
4. Is payment immediate or delayed?
Payment is typically confirmed at checkout before processing begins.
5. Can I cancel after payment?
Cancellation depends on whether the seller has started processing.
6. How do I know if a seller is reliable?
Users rely on historical fulfillment patterns and product consistency.
7. Are shipping fees fixed?
No, they depend on weight, region, and method.
8. How long does delivery take?
Usually 3–10 days depending on logistics selection.
9. What if my item arrives damaged?
Resolution depends on seller policy and platform support process.
10. Can I track my parcel in real time?
Yes, tracking updates are available after dispatch.
11. Is there a minimum order requirement?
No fixed minimum, but consolidation is recommended.
12. Can I buy from multiple sellers at once?
Yes, multi-seller carts are supported through consolidation.
